Today I had the pleasure of interviewing Breylor Grout. Breylor is a data analyst who has built his work lifestyle around his full time competitive Jiu Jitsu career. He was born and raised in San Diego, and graduated from Cal Poly Saint louis obispo in 2017 with a major in math with minor in statistics. Since graduating he’s been putting more and more time into Brazilian jiu jitsu, which he has been training since 2010 but did not compete consistently until a after graduating from college. More recently, Breylor won the IBJJF No-Gi brown belt pans and was featured on “Who Next” the jiu-jitsu equivalent of the ultimate fighter. In this episode we talk about how Breylor was able to find a role in analytics that matched his training schedule, the surprising similarities between Jiu Jitsu and data analytics, and why maybe you should explore the sport in your free time.
